A Rich Man's Darling is a 1918 American silent comedy drama film directed by Edgar Jones and starring Louise Lovely, Edna Maison and Philo McCullough.[1]
Cast
- Louise Lovely as Julie Le Fabrier
- Edna Maison as Madame Ricardo
- Philo McCullough as Lee Brooks
- Harry Mann as Enrico Ricardo
- Harry Holden as Mason Brooks
